The BS in Business Intelligence and Analytics is designed for students who want to bridge the gap between business and technology. In today's data-driven world, companies rely on professionals who can interpret complex data, identify trends, and make informed business decisions. This program provides students with a strong foundation in business, computation, and technology, focusing on real-world applications of data analysis, artificial intelligence, and machine learning in business settings. With companies increasingly relying on data to gain a competitive edge, graduates of this program will be highly sought after in both corporate and entrepreneurial settings.

Students will complete 144 credit hours, including general education, interdisciplinary courses, and specialized major courses. The program also includes a mandatory internship (3 credit hours), allowing students to gain hands-on experience in industries where data-driven decision-making is essential. Graduates of this program will be prepared to work in industries such as banking, retail, healthcare, e-commerce, manufacturing, and consulting, HR, Supply chain domain. They will develop the skills to create and implement data-driven business strategies in the corporate world.
